Bonnie Donahue Obituary

We are sad to announce that on November 25, 2022, at the age of 88, Bonnie Donahue (Bellingham, Washington) passed away. Family and friends are welcome to leave their condolences on this memorial page and share them with the family.

She was loved and cherished by many people including : her husband Don Donahue; her children, Debra, Don and Julie; her parents, Vera Bonner and Curtis Bonner; her siblings, Alice, Lois and Van Zandt; and her caregiver License. She was also cherished by Grandma Bonnie leaves behind nine grandchildren and ten great-grandchildren.

Bonnie spent the final 10 years of her life in the loving care of the Christian Health Care Center (CHCC) in Lynden, WA as she adapted to life with Alzheimer's disease. CHCC surrounded Bonnie with love and support as she navigated the difficult transitions of Alzheimer's.
